From 4cc85448d7d8c7769b9a4ae4b3dab14335b04ef2 Mon Sep 17 00:00:00 2001
From: "maor.rayzin" <maorrayzin@guardicore.com>
Date: Mon, 26 Nov 2018 14:01:46 +0200
Subject: [PATCH] * add instance id to domain issues too

---
 monkey/monkey_island/cc/services/report.py | 3 +++
 1 file changed, 3 insertions(+)

diff --git a/monkey/monkey_island/cc/services/report.py b/monkey/monkey_island/cc/services/report.py
index 7f4864e60..a75fdb7dd 100644
--- a/monkey/monkey_island/cc/services/report.py
+++ b/monkey/monkey_island/cc/services/report.py
@@ -542,8 +542,11 @@ class ReportService:
         for issue in issues:
             if not issue.get('is_local', True):
                 machine = issue.get('machine').upper()
+                aws_instance_id = ReportService.get_machine_aws_instance_id(issue.get('machine'))
                 if machine not in domain_issues_dict:
                     domain_issues_dict[machine] = []
+                if aws_instance_id:
+                    issue['aws_instance_id'] = aws_instance_id
                 domain_issues_dict[machine].append(issue)
         logger.info('Domain issues generated for reporting')
         return domain_issues_dict